Abstract

The invention discloses a method and device for ensuring low-load stable operation of gas supply machines. The method is characterized in that one group of gas supply machines is used for supplying gas for users; when gas load of gas users is lower than lowest gas supply capacity of the gas supply machines, surplus gas is returned to an intake master pipe or washer inlet through a recirculation pipeline connected to a user master pipe, and normal operation of the gas supply machines can be guaranteed. By adding the recirculation pipeline between the user master pipe and the intake master pipe, the surplus gas is returned to the intake master pipe or washer inlet so as to reduce pressure of the user master pipe and to ensure that the gas pressure of user terminals is kept in a safety range. The method and device has the advantages that the gas supply machines with the same specification are adopted, frequent start and stop of the gas supply machines with different specifications can be avoided, workload of production personnel is reduced, the number of specifications of equipment spare parts is greatly decreased, production management is facilitated, and production cost is greatly lowered.
